Perez: Force India has to be ‘perfect’ to beat McLaren

Sergio Perez believes Force India will have to execute “perfect” weekends in the final two races of the 2018 Formula 1 season if it is to overhaul McLaren. The rebranded Force India squad currently sits seventh in the constructors’ standings and trails McLaren by 15 points after forfeiting its previous tally following its summer takeover by a Lawrence Stroll led consortium.
